Straight out of the silica sand and this is the moment I hold my breath. For two reasons; at this stage the flowers are at their most fragile, a wrong move and a petal can crumble. The other, they're just beautiful and I don't know what treasures will be unearthed.

But look at the 3D form and the colour. This is what makes silica gel preservation so good - see that tiny tulip? It looks exactly as it did when it went in. Some flowers just take to the sand perfectly and this one nailed it.

Natives preservation is one at scale - usually a tray can fit about half a bouquet of flowers. Here the tray only takes two proteas. This one will make a great focal point for the artwork and I wanted to give it room to dry thoroughly.

Air drying these would have worked too, but I wanted to try to get some of the lighter colouring to stay and silica works faster.

This week's preservation highlight is Cherish's native bouquet. King proteas, eucalyptus, pampas grass, wax flower, and ranunculus โ€” earthy, wild, and completely stunning.

I haven't had a native bouquet come through in quite a while and they're very different to work with. Whilst sturdier and easier to dry, the flowers are on a much larger scale.
